The foundation of any successful chest development program lies in understanding the anatomy of the pectoral muscles. The pectoralis major, the largest chest muscle, is divided into two main heads: the clavicular head (upper chest) and the sternocostal head (mid and lower chest). The pectoralis minor, located beneath the pectoralis major, plays a crucial role in shoulder blade movement and contributes to a lifted appearance. A well-rounded workout routine must address all these areas to achieve balanced growth and definition. Compound exercises are paramount for stimulating significant muscle hypertrophy. The bench press, in its various forms, is arguably the king of chest exercises. A barbell bench press allows for the heaviest loads, effectively targeting the sternocostal head of the pectoralis major. Dumbbell bench presses offer a greater range of motion and allow for independent arm work, which can help identify and address muscular imbalances. Incline bench presses, using dumbbells or a barbell, specifically target the clavicular head, contributing to that desired upper chest fullness. Decline bench presses, while less commonly emphasized for pure aesthetics, engage the lower pectorals. Beyond the bench press variations, other compound movements play a vital role. The overhead press, while primarily a shoulder exercise, also significantly engages the upper chest and triceps, contributing to overall upper body power and a balanced physique. Push-ups are an incredibly versatile bodyweight exercise that can be modified to target different areas of the chest. Standard push-ups work the entire pectoral region, while close-grip push-ups place more emphasis on the triceps and inner chest, and decline push-ups target the upper chest. Dips, when performed with a forward lean, can also be an effective chest builder, particularly targeting the lower pectorals. Isolation exercises, while secondary to compound movements, are essential for refining specific areas and enhancing muscle definition. Dumbbell flyes, performed on a flat, incline, or decline bench, allow for a deep stretch of the pectoral muscles, promoting hypertrophy and improving chest separation. Cable crossovers, utilizing various angles and resistance levels, offer continuous tension throughout the movement, further contributing to muscle stimulation and definition. Pec deck machines provide a controlled and stable environment for isolating the chest muscles. For individuals specifically seeking to enhance the appearance of their breasts, it’s crucial to understand that direct breast tissue growth is not achievable through exercise. The breasts are primarily composed of glandular tissue and fat. However, building the pectoral muscles underneath can create a fuller, more lifted appearance, giving the illusion of increased size and improved shape. This is where the "big boob workout" concept truly comes into play. By strengthening and hypertrophyzing the pectoralis muscles, the foundation upon which the breasts rest is enhanced. Posture plays a significant role in how the chest is perceived. Slouching can make the chest appear smaller and less prominent. Strengthening the upper back muscles, such as the rhomboids and trapezius, along with the rear deltoids, is crucial for maintaining an upright posture and allowing the chest muscles to be displayed more effectively. Exercises like rows, pull-ups, and face pulls are vital components of a balanced upper body program that indirectly contribute to chest aesthetics by improving posture. Progressive overload is the principle of continually challenging the muscles to adapt and grow. This can be achieved by gradually increasing the weight lifted, the number of repetitions or sets performed, or by decreasing rest times between sets. For instance, if an individual can comfortably perform 10 repetitions of a bench press with a certain weight, the next session they might aim for 11 or 12, or increase the weight slightly while aiming for the same number of reps. This constant adaptation is what drives muscle hypertrophy.

Warm-up routines are crucial for preparing the body for exercise, reducing the risk of injury, and enhancing performance. A good warm-up for a chest workout typically includes light cardio to increase blood flow, followed by dynamic stretching and mobility exercises that target the shoulders, chest, and upper back.
